2 Articles
1 / 1

Currently, the UK has one of the most expensive car taxation systems in the world. Besides VAT (sales tax) at time of purchase, drivers in Britain must pay fuel taxes and a road tax (Vehicle Excise Duty) a corporate tax (for fleets), and sometimes a Congestion Charge, as in London. Manchester is about to vote on a congestion tax as well.

1 / 1
Share This Post

Cartax Questions

There are no questions about this topic.
Be the first to ask!

From Our Partners